'My MMA Gym Will Be Empty': Chechens Head To Ukraine To Fight Kadyrov
When Kyiv announced it disrupted a plot by Chechen warlord Ramzan Kadyrov to assassinate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y, young Chechen men already preparing to head to fight for Ukraine took it as confirmation theyd have another chance to fight Vladimir Putins Russia and his key henchman at the same time.
With a population of two million under Kadyrovs semi-autonomous rule, Chechnyas two vicious civil wars in the 1990s and increasingly brutal rule by Kadyrov have combined to create a Chechen diaspora community across Europe and Turkey in the hundreds of thousands. Hundreds of them now appear ready to join the fight to defend Ukraine.
Kadyrovtsy are in Ukraine fighting alongside the Russians, that makes it every Chechen mans responsibility to confront the enemies of Chechnya and our faith, according to Ramzan, a former jihadist fighter in Syria from Chechnya quietly living in exile in Turkey, speaking under a pseudonym. Kadyrov and his clan control the [Russian-loyal security services] and hunt his political opponents in Russia, in Chechnya, and in Europe.
But now they are in Ukraine for Putin and we can hunt them again, he said. We know these men [sent to kill Zelenskyy] who work for Putins dog [Kadyrov].
Ukraine has requested foreign volunteers, particularly those with specific military skills. It has already has received more applications than it can immediately vet for links to criminal or terrorist organisations, according to a Ukrainian Defence Ministry official interviewed by VICE World News.
